WEAN-FM

WEAN-FM (99.7 MHz, "News Talk 99.7 FM & AM 630 WPRO") is a radio station licensed to Wakefield-Peacedale, Rhode Island.

As a simulcast of WPRO, much of WEAN-FM's programming is locally produced, with programs hosted by WJAR anchor Gene Vallicenti, Matt Allen, Dan Yorke, and former WLNE-TV reporter Tara Granahan.

Syndicated programming includes John Batchelor and Red Eye Radio.
